1991 Hood Blisters

I just picked up a nice set of hood blisters for my 91 RS. I have been told that they go in the same locations as the IROC louvers, but I want to be sure. Also, does anyone know if there is a template that someone has made around this site, or elsewhere for locating the exact locations for the holes. I'm scared to death to put drill holes in the wrong location. Thanks guys

Re: 1991 Hood Blisters

well if you have a RS you should have a falt hood and factory hood blisters wont work cause z28 hoods are indented for them to fit in, what you need is the ones that hawks makes for flat hoods
